Audi does not want to be left behind.The German premium brand is playing catch-up with its arch-rival BMW and will be putting up its own test track at the Frankfurt motor show this September.

Integrated into its exhibition hall at the famed auto show will be a 400-meter (1312 ft) long track that loops into the building from outside. Audi will allow visitors to test drive about a dozen different models, including race cars.

"We'll make a strong statement," says Audi CEO Rupert Stadler. "It'll be surprising, emotional, architecturally great, with a real wow effect."BMW put up a test track at the Frankfurt show in 2009 and Mercedes-Benz quickly followed suit too.

The 3 German premium brands have gotten more competitive in their spending on car shows recently as each try to outdo the other two and create more of an impact for their marques.
The Frankfurt motor show takes place September 15 to the 25 (public days).

The engine of the 2011 Audi Sport Cars A1 Clubsport quattro Concept  is a conventional gasoline engine – a  five-cylinder unit displacing 2.5-liter with direct fuel injection and turbocharging. Compared to the version used in the Audi TT, RS, and RS3 Sportback, which it is based, has production in the TFSI has significantly increased to 370 kW (503 hp) and 660 Nm (486.79 pounds ft) of torque. The maximum power is available between 2,500 and 5,300 rpm. With the six-speed manual transmission and Quattro permanent all-wheel drive, both taken from the TT RS and enhanced, deliver the power to all four wheels.
2011 Audi Sport Cars A1 Clubsport quattro Concept
The turbocharger, intercooler, admission tract and the exhaust line have been systematically tuned for high performance, and just like on Audi’s DTM race cars, the tailpipe is located on the left flank, just in front of the rear wheel. The 2011 Audi Sport Cars A1 Clubsport quattro Concept with its total weight of just 1,390 kg (3,064 pounds). The powerful engine propels the car from 0 to 100 km / h (62.14 mph) in 3.7 seconds. 0 to 200 km / h (124.27 mph) takes just 10.9 seconds while the car goes from 80 to 120 km / h (49.71 to 74.56 mph) in fourth gear in just 2, 4 seconds. A gearbox six-speed manual and four-wheel drive, Top speed the 2011 Audi Sport Cars A1 Clubsport quattro Concept is governed to 250 km / h (155.34 mph).
2011 Audi Sport Cars A1 Clubsport quattro Concept
Some special elements include a carbon fiber roof, a black honeycomb designed grille, widened fenders, a double blade rear wing and a huge rear diffuser. The interior has also been stripped out, with many of the standard pieces being replaced with either carbon fiber or aluminum. Three custom instruments indicate the oil pressure, boost pressure and electrical system voltage, and red four-point belts secure the driver and passenger.
The 2011 Audi Sport Cars A1 Clubsport quattro Concept showcar rolls on 255/30 low-profile tires mounted on 19-inch alloy wheels with a unique turbine design. Sitting behind the wheels are large, internally ventilated disc brakes. Up front, six-piston calipers grab perforated carbon fiber-ceramic discs. Large steel discs are mounted on the rear axle. The coilover suspension of the Audi A1 clubsport quattro features adjustable compression and rebound damping.

First up is the S8, which is expected to make its debut at the Frankfurt motor show in September.

The S8 will feature a new 4.0 liter, twin-turbo V8, developed together and shared with sister brand Bentley, with an output of approximately 500 PS (368 kW / 493 bhp). That beats the previous S8 by 50 PS but the new model will still outdo it on fuel-economy by about 20 percent. The S8 will come with an 8-speed automatic gearbox and Quattro all-wheel drive as standard.

Following on its heels will be an introduction of the 2012 Audi S6 and S7 models at the Los Angeles auto show. Both the S6 and the S7 also get the new 4.0 liter V8, with 440 PS (324 kW / 434 bhp) and 470 PS (346 kW / 464 bhp), respectively. Although, Auto Bild doesn't specify whether they get naturally-aspirated, single-turbo or twin-turbo variants of the unit.

Finally, comes the RS6 which will get that 4.0 liter, twin-turbo V8 too as Audi appears to be making the most out of the power plant. The unit will be configured to deliver 580 PS (427 kW / 572 bhp) and keep the model competitive with its arch-rival - the recently unveiled BMW (F10) M5 which comes with 560 PS (412 kW / 552 hp) and 680 Nm (502 lb-ft) of torque.

We've also previously reported that an RS7 is expected with that 4.0 liter, twin-turbo V8 tuned to around the 600 PS (441 kW / 592 bhp) mark.

Audi, the German luxury car manufacturer has announced the launch of the Audi Q5 2.0 TDI quattro, the most recent addition to the highly successful luxury SUV in India. The new Audi Q5 2.0 TDI q is priced at Rs3,905,000 (ex-showroom Maharashtra). Deliveries to customers will begin in April 2011.

“We are confident that the addition of the powerful 2.0 TDI q engine to the Audi Q5 range in India will strengthen and sustain our leadership position in the luxury SUV segment. The all new Audi Q5 2.0 TDI q, resonates higher efficiency and dynamic performance with its new engine and refreshed array of characteristics, that reflect our core brand essence of „Vorsprung durch Technik‟,” said Michael Perschke, Head – Audi India.

The Audi Q5 2.0 TDI q with 125kW / 170 hp reaches a maximum torque of 350 Nm 1,750 rpm and develops its power evenly, leading to a fascinating driving experience. It is equipped with the dynamic 7–speed automatic S tronic transmission, which is impressive for its short, sporty shift times and smooth gearshift across the entire spread between the shortest and the longest ratios. 2/3

The Audi Q5 range is also powered by a petrol engine – the 2.0 TFSI q and a diesel engine – the 3.0 TDI q. The new 2.0 TDI q engine would be available as CKD.

Audi India sold 3003 cars in 2010, exceeding targets yet again to achieve record growth of 81%. “This encouraging performance reinforces the increased aspiration for technical finesse and progressive sophistication among luxury automotive customers in India. Audi India will continue to expand its product line up and deliver path breaking and award winning cars to cater to this rising need,” added Michael Perschke.

Audi India is also focused at strengthening its dealer network across India. This year, the brand with the four rings has already opened showrooms in Delhi and Chennai with Ludhiana to follow soon. Last year, the company inaugurated showrooms in Mumbai West, Kolkata, Jaipur and Bengaluru.

The Audi model range in India includes Audi A4, Audi A6, Audi A8, Audi Q5, Audi Q7, Audi TT, the super sports car Audi R8 and the recently launched Audi R8 Spyder available across the country: in Ahmedabad, Bengaluru, Chandigarh, Chennai, Delhi, Gurgaon, Hyderabad, Jaipur, Kochi, Kolkata, Ludhiana, Mumbai West and Pune. Further developments include Surat, Mumbai South, Coimbatore, Indore, Lucknow and Delhi West.

The RSQ includes special features suggested by movie director Alex Proyas. The mid-engined sports car operated by the story's police department, races through the Chicago of the future not on wheels but on spheres. Its two doors are rear-hinged to the C-posts of the body and open according to the butterfly principle.

The striking shape of the angular body cutouts for the head-light modules influence the front-end appearance of the RSQ. They are combined with side air inlets. The xenon light tubes behind the clear-glass covers enhance the character of the front-end design.

Where you find the rear window on most sports coupes, an aluminium hood covers the engine in the RSQ. In plain view this cover is an oval, running right up to the windscreen and integrated into the body by a transverse bar.The gull-wing doors are another RSQ highlight: whenever Will Smith gets into or out of the car, the rear-hinged doors open upwards like a butterfly's wings, and twist slightly at the same time.

The cockpit atmosphere of the interior is emphasized by the wide panoramic windscreen that extends back into the roof. The glass surface runs from the right and left roof pillars as far as the rear of the cabin. This ensures a much greater field of view for the driver and passenger.

All relevant information for driving the car is fed into the digital display in the instrument cluster by means of Audi s Multi Media Interface (MMI) control system. The air conditioning and radio of the RSQ are classified as secondary functions. Entertainment functions have been omitted in favor of the sporting concept.

German sources are reporting today that the Ingolstadt manufacturer is planning to develop the Audi A9, which is expected to go on sale sometime in 2014. The A9 will be one of Audi's top models, which will offer even more luxury and equipment than the current generation Audi A8. The 2014 Audi A9 will be based on the same platform as the A8, but it will not be a sedan. Measuring around 5 meters in length, Audi's A9 will be available as a four-seat coupe and convertible only. Can you even imagine such a long coupe? The Audi A9 convertible will have a canvas soft-top, and, together with the coupe model, will feature fully retractable side windows.

The Audi A9 coupe's most obvious competitor will
be the Mercedes CL, while the convertible version might go on the same market segment as the SL. Merc's CL has long been alone on the large coupe segment, so the A9 doesn't seem such an eccentric idea.

If it will ever be a reality, the Audi A9 will probably get the larger petrol and diesel engines in the car maker's line-up. Our sources expect the Audi A9 to be priced from around 80,000 EUR.

The R18's headlights, which are the first to completely consist of LEDs with optimized amount of light, are a technical highlight. The new generation of headlights was developed in close cooperation between Audi Sport Cars and the Technical Development (TE) division of AÚDI AG and by using at Le Mans, will be prepared for future use in production vehicles. Audi's light designers had the chance to make their mark on the development as well: The LEDs of the daytime light form the shape of a '1' which is intended to inspire associations with Audi's historic brand logo.

Significantly smaller engines than those used before will be prescribed at Le Mans in 2011 as the rule makers aim to achieve a substantial reduction of engine power. By opting for a 3.7-liter V6 TDI unit, Audi retains the diesel concept that saw its first victorious fielding in 2006. ‘From our point of view, the TDI continues to be the most efficient technology,’ says Úlrich Baretzky, Head of Engine Development at Audi Sport Cars. ‘There are good reasons why the share of TDI units among Audi’s production models is as high as it is.’
Through the innovative V6 TDI engine for the Le Mans 24 Hours, motorsport is yet again performing pioneering work for the production arm at Audi where there is a growing trend towards smaller, more economical but yet powerful engines. Another new development is the six-speed transmission in the R18 which has been specifically modified for use with the smaller engine. Development of new Audi R18 began in mid-2009. V6 TDI engine has been running on dynamometers since the summer of 2010. The 2011 Audi Sports Cars Racing R18 TDI, with Allan McNish at the wheel, has achieved the first essay on horse racing at the end of November.
The racing debut of the Audi R18 racing planned for Spa-Francorchamps (Belgium) 6 hours on 8 May 2011. Audi’s all-electric e-tron concept, which debuted at the 2009 Frankfurt Motor Show, surprised us by showing up at the 2009 Los Angeles in a decidedly unique paint scheme. Headed for production with the nameplate of R4, the e-tron is a high-performance electric sports coupe created in the same vein as the less-than-green R8.

Although technically not an electric version of Audi’s R8 supercar, the e-tron concepts places a heavy emphasis on all-out performance and shares a considerable amount of design language as well. The e-tron features independent electric motors at all four corners, giving the concept a true quattro all-wheel drive system. Combined output is 313 horsepower and a staggering 3,319 lb-ft or torque.

That power is enough to accelerate the e-tron from zero-to-62 in 4.8 seconds. The rush from 37-75 mph is accomplished in 4.1 seconds, according to Audi.The e-tron utilizes a lithium-ion battery back, located low and behind the passenger compartment for optimal weight distribution (42/58). Audi says the e-tron carries enough juice for a 154 mile optimal range. Audi enlists all LED lighting and other power saving features ensure that maximum range.

Aside from the massive 1,036 pound battery pack, the e-tron is fairly light at its total weight of 3,527 pounds. Its low weight comes courtesy of an Audi Space Frame designed aluminum structure. All of what Audi calls the “add on” parts, like doors, hoods, roof and fenders are composed of fiber-reinforced plastic for added weight savings.

The show car features a production-like interior with simplistic controls and a revised MMI scroll pad with a touch-sensitive surface on the steering wheel, as well as a unique smart phone integration setup. The car is designed to allow users to insert specially-equipped smartphones into a slot in order to utilize the phone’s built-in audio and video capabilities.

Audi has confirmed that it will use its newly established and dedicated e-tron sub-brand to develop the production version of the e-tron. Audi set a target run of 1,000 units worldwide, but said it will only produce units that are pre-ordered, meaning the final number produced could fall short if the demand isn’t there.

The elegant Audi A7 is the latest in the new class of luxury cars that European automakers like to call "four-door coupes."

The goal of building a four-door car with the silhouette of a coupe has created some of the loveliest designs on wheels, however, including the new A7. The A7 is based on a concept car Audi unveiled at the Detroit auto show a few years ago.

Releasing this spring, the new Audi A7 debuted at the Detroit Auto Show to please Audi fans even more. A few years ago, Audi unveiled a concept car, and that concept car became the base of the A7.

The new “four door coupe” from Audi features Quattro all-wheel drive standard with an strong and efficient 3.0-liter turbocharged direct-injection V6 and an eight-speed automatic transmission.

Another feature of the new Audi is the increased storage space. At about 195 inches, the A7 measures about an inch and a half longer than the new Audi A6.
